AMTK coach 7612         
Former Amtrak coach 7612 had been built by Budd in 1951 as Pennsylvania Railroad 1593, one of 32 66-seat coaches with 14-seat smoking sections for service on the CONGRESSIONAL LIMITED and the SENATOR. It retained its original number on the Penn Central 1593 and was assigned Amtrak 7423 in 1976; but it retained its PRR/PC number until it was remodeled into high-capacity HEP CLOCKER car 7612 in November 1981. Amtrak sold the car to the Panarail Tourism Co. in 2000 and its tread brake trucks replaced the disc brake trucks under a 7000-series handicap accessible car that went to Panama.
